英文摘要Strain SYSU D60016(T), a rod-shaped bacterium that tends to form clusters, was isolated from a soil sample collected from the Gurbantunggut desert, China. Cells were Gram-stain-negative, catalase-negative and oxidase-positive. The 16S rRNA gene sequence of strain SYSU D60016(T) shared less than 94 % sequence identity with members of the family Hymenobacteraceae. The strain exhibited growth at 15-50 degrees C, pH 6-8 and in the presence of up to 3% (w/v) NaCl. Its chemotaxonomic features included MK-7 as the respiratory menaquinone, iso-C 15: 0 and summed feature 4 (iso-C-17:1 I and/or anteiso-C-17:1 B) as major cellular fatty acids and phosphatidylethanolamine as the main polar lipid. The DNA G+C content was determined to be 50.1 % (genome). Analyses of the phylogenetic data and differences in the chemotaxonomic and biochemical features from related genera in the family Hymenobacteraceae indicated that strain SYSU D60016(T) merits representation of a novel species of a novel genus in the family Hymenobacteraceae. The name Botryobacter ruber gen. nov., sp. nov. is, therefore, proposed to represent the phylogenetic position of strain SYSU D60016(T) in the family Hymenobacteraceae. The type strain of the proposed new taxon is SYSU D60016(T) (=KCTC 52794 T =NBRC 112957(T)).
